Output d502421a188fe03cbe3d2e6a71232977ad1294aac91a2b7cb49726ec83183aa1:1

value
582733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c056ef9d1b260656e5c8b7312d6259250b95b95b OP_EQUAL
address
3KE1onzQkQWEWymTpKF6g8qKaBDMZMbVK3
transaction
d502421a188fe03cbe3d2e6a71232977ad1294aac91a2b7cb49726ec83183aa1
confirmations
151858
spent
true